Natália Duarte is a Brazilian singer-songwriter from Salvador, Bahia. She started performing in local bars and festivals, developing a style that mixes traditional Brazilian rhythms with contemporary pop.
Her 2018 single "Vaso de Barro" became a hit across Brazil. The song's melody and lyrics about love and loss connected with listeners and brought her national attention.
Duarte's music sometimes addresses social issues and women's empowerment, which has drawn both support and criticism. She has continued to release music, including her 2019 debut album "Simplesmente" and another song called "O Construtor."
